    Unfortunately it only takes one bad experience to ruin a businesses reputation. This is the 4th car…read moreI've taken here to have the tint installed, I will say they are pricey but WERE worth the cost. The initial 3 interactions were very professional and hassle free. Showed up, they walked me through what I wanted and how much it would cost, I left, there were done in 2-3 hours, I paid, that was it. Great experience. This last time was not. I dropped off my 2026 Acura Integra Type S (which had less than 800 miles on it) off, informed the guy I wasn't interested in paying so much like last time, ($640 for the step above basic tint) and was wondering if they could work with me on the price, they couldn't, oh well. And like the other times I drop my car off, they're done within 2-3 hours and I come to pick it up. The first thing I notice is the car was filthy, I dropped it off spotless, salt shot up the sides of the car like it was doing highway speeds. I go into pay, get my keys, come out to the car and start it up, Every light on the dash that could be on, was on. Not to mention my alcantara seats were dirty. So I drive off and immediately call them, they explain "this happens all the time just drive it." I drive it at all speeds for 30 mins and the lights still are on. I call them back again and explain, and tell them "this only happens when the battery is deep cycled". Long story short they let my cars battery die, and said they could reset the light, they had some guy from the shop drive my car (it's a 6 speed manual) trying to reset the light which didn't work. They explained it was completely normal for this to happen because they need the car on they just forgot to hook up a battery charger, so I had to take it to the dealer to have the battery "charged and reconditioned and have basic settings parameters set". The owner or whatever he was maintained complete deniability throughout this whole thing and stuck to the "this is completely normal it happens all the time" script.
